Agent Reasoning Block Implementation Plan

Overview

Replace the current tool call banner with a new Agent Reasoning Block - a multi-line collapsible block that shows the agent's reasoning process during execution, then collapses to "Thought for N s" during final response streaming.


Design Reference

During Agent Loop (Expanded):

┌──────────────────────────────────────────────────┐
│ ⠿ Reasoning · 9s                                 │
│                                                  │
│ • Searching notes for "machine learning"         │
│ • Found 5 relevant notes, analyzing content      │
└──────────────────────────────────────────────────┘

During Final Response (Collapsed):

┌──────────────────────────────────────────────────┐
│ ▸ Thought for 12s                                │
└──────────────────────────────────────────────────┘

After Response Complete (Expandable):

┌──────────────────────────────────────────────────┐
│ ▸ Thought for 12s                [click to expand] │
└──────────────────────────────────────────────────┘

Naming

Term Description
Agent Reasoning Block The full UI component
Reasoning Steps Individual bullet points (1-2 per iteration)
Reasoning Timer Elapsed seconds counter

Architecture

State Machine

┌─────────────┐     tool call      ┌─────────────┐
│   IDLE      │ ────────────────▶  │  REASONING  │
└─────────────┘                    └─────────────┘
                                         │
                                         │ final response starts
                                         ▼
                                   ┌─────────────┐
                                   │  COLLAPSED  │
                                   └─────────────┘
                                         │
                                         │ response complete
                                         ▼
                                   ┌─────────────┐
                                   │  COMPLETE   │
                                   └─────────────┘

Data Flow

AutonomousAgentChainRunner
    │
    ├── onReasoningStart(timestamp)
    │       └── Start timer, set state = REASONING
    │
    ├── onReasoningStep(summary: string)
    │       └── Add bullet point to steps array
    │
    ├── onReasoningEnd()
    │       └── Set state = COLLAPSED, stop timer
    │
    └── Final streaming via updateCurrentAiMessage
            └── Normal text streaming (block stays collapsed)

Implementation Phases

Phase 1: Data Model & State

File: src/LLMProviders/chainRunner/utils/AgentReasoningState.ts (new)

export interface ReasoningStep {
  timestamp: number;
  summary: string; // e.g., "Searching notes for 'AI'"
  toolName?: string;
}

export interface AgentReasoningState {
  status: "idle" | "reasoning" | "collapsed" | "complete";
  startTime: number | null;
  elapsedSeconds: number;
  steps: ReasoningStep[];
}

export function createInitialReasoningState(): AgentReasoningState {
  return {
    status: "idle",
    startTime: null,
    elapsedSeconds: 0,
    steps: [],
  };
}

// Serialize to marker format (embedded in message)
export function serializeReasoningBlock(state: AgentReasoningState): string {
  const data = {
    elapsed: state.elapsedSeconds,
    steps: state.steps.map((s) => s.summary),
  };
  return `<!--REASONING_BLOCK:${JSON.stringify(data)}-->`;
}

// Parse from marker format
export function parseReasoningBlock(marker: string): { elapsed: number; steps: string[] } | null {
  const match = marker.match(/<!--REASONING_BLOCK:(.+?)-->/);
  if (!match) return null;
  try {
    return JSON.parse(match[1]);
  } catch {
    return null;
  }
}

Phase 2: Update AutonomousAgentChainRunner

File: src/LLMProviders/chainRunner/AutonomousAgentChainRunner.ts

Changes:

  1. Add reasoning state tracking:
private reasoningState: AgentReasoningState = createInitialReasoningState();
private reasoningTimerInterval: NodeJS.Timeout | null = null;
  1. Add helper methods:
private startReasoningTimer(updateFn: (message: string) => void): void {
  this.reasoningState = {
    status: 'reasoning',
    startTime: Date.now(),
    elapsedSeconds: 0,
    steps: [],
  };

  // Update every 100ms for responsive timer
  this.reasoningTimerInterval = setInterval(() => {
    if (this.reasoningState.startTime) {
      this.reasoningState.elapsedSeconds = Math.floor(
        (Date.now() - this.reasoningState.startTime) / 1000
      );
      // Emit updated reasoning block
      updateFn(this.buildReasoningBlockMarkup());
    }
  }, 100);
}

private addReasoningStep(summary: string): void {
  // Keep only last 2 steps for concise display
  this.reasoningState.steps.push({
    timestamp: Date.now(),
    summary,
  });
  if (this.reasoningState.steps.length > 2) {
    this.reasoningState.steps.shift();
  }
}

private stopReasoningTimer(): void {
  if (this.reasoningTimerInterval) {
    clearInterval(this.reasoningTimerInterval);
    this.reasoningTimerInterval = null;
  }
  this.reasoningState.status = 'collapsed';
}

private buildReasoningBlockMarkup(): string {
  const { status, elapsedSeconds, steps } = this.reasoningState;

  if (status === 'idle') return '';

  // Use special marker that ChatSingleMessage will parse
  const stepsJson = JSON.stringify(steps.map(s => s.summary));
  return `<!--AGENT_REASONING:${status}:${elapsedSeconds}:${stepsJson}-->`;
}
  1. Integrate into agent loop:
async run(...) {
  // Start reasoning timer at beginning
  this.startReasoningTimer(updateCurrentAiMessage);

  try {
    // ... agent loop ...

    // When executing a tool:
    this.addReasoningStep(`Calling ${toolName}...`);
    updateCurrentAiMessage(this.buildReasoningBlockMarkup());

    // After tool result:
    this.addReasoningStep(this.summarizeToolResult(toolName, result));
    updateCurrentAiMessage(this.buildReasoningBlockMarkup());

    // When final response starts:
    this.stopReasoningTimer();
    const collapsedBlock = this.buildReasoningBlockMarkup();

    // Stream final response AFTER the collapsed block
    for await (const chunk of stream) {
      updateCurrentAiMessage(collapsedBlock + chunk);
    }

  } finally {
    this.stopReasoningTimer();
  }
}
  1. Add step summarization helper:
private summarizeToolResult(toolName: string, result: any): string {
  switch (toolName) {
    case 'localSearch':
      const count = result?.documents?.length || 0;
      return `Found ${count} relevant note${count !== 1 ? 's' : ''}`;
    case 'webSearch':
      return 'Retrieved web search results';
    case 'getTimeRangeMs':
      return 'Calculated time range';
    default:
      return `Completed ${toolName}`;
  }
}

Phase 6: Remove Old Tool Call Banner

Files to modify:

  1. src/components/chat-components/ToolCallBanner.tsx - Delete or deprecate
  2. src/components/chat-components/toolCallRootManager.tsx - Simplify or remove
  3. src/LLMProviders/chainRunner/utils/toolCallParser.ts - Keep for backward compat with saved messages
  4. src/LLMProviders/chainRunner/utils/ThinkBlockStreamer.ts - Remove tool call marker handling

Deprecation strategy:

  • Keep parseToolCallMarkers() for rendering old saved messages
  • Remove createToolCallMarker() and updateToolCallMarker()
  • Don't create new tool call markers in agent runner

Phase 7: Disable Thinking Block in Agent Mode

File: src/LLMProviders/chainRunner/utils/ThinkBlockStreamer.ts

Add flag to skip thinking content extraction in agent mode:

export class ThinkBlockStreamer {
  private suppressThinkingContent: boolean;

  constructor(
    updateFn: (message: string) => void,
    options?: { suppressThinkingContent?: boolean }
  ) {
    this.updateFn = updateFn;
    this.suppressThinkingContent = options?.suppressThinkingContent ?? false;
  }

  processChunk(chunk: any): void {
    if (this.suppressThinkingContent) {
      // Skip thinking content, only extract text
      // ... simplified logic ...
    } else {
      // ... existing thinking block logic ...
    }
  }
}

In AutonomousAgentChainRunner:

const streamer = new ThinkBlockStreamer(updateCurrentAiMessage, {
  suppressThinkingContent: true, // Agent mode uses AgentReasoningBlock instead
});

Performance Considerations

  1. Timer Updates: Use 100ms interval for responsive feel without excessive re-renders
  2. Step Limit: Keep only last 2 steps to prevent DOM bloat
  3. Marker Format: Compact JSON for minimal message overhead
  4. React Roots: Use same pattern as tool call banner for persistent roots

Migration Path

  1. Phase 1: Add new AgentReasoningBlock alongside existing tool call banner
  2. Phase 2: Test with agent mode, ensure backward compat with old messages
  3. Phase 3: Remove tool call banner creation code (keep parsing)
  4. Phase 4: Clean up deprecated code after stable release

Testing Checklist

  • Timer updates smoothly (no flicker)
  • Steps appear as tools execute
  • Block collapses when final response starts
  • Collapsed block shows correct elapsed time
  • Click to expand works after response complete
  • Old messages with tool call banners still render
  • No thinking blocks appear in agent mode
  • Performance: no lag with multiple iterations
